Fix log and analytics bugs

This commit is contained in:
problematicconsumer
2023-10-03 21:12:14 +03:30
parent ba071643ce
commit 8f15022443
16 changed files with 86 additions and 57 deletions

View File

@@ -25,9 +25,9 @@ Future<List<InstalledPackageInfo>> installedPackagesInfo(
return ref
.watch(platformSettingsProvider)
.getInstalledPackages()
.getOrElse((l) {
_logger.warning("error getting installed packages: $l");
throw l;
.getOrElse((err) {
_logger.warning("error getting installed packages", err);
throw err;
}).run();
}
@@ -40,9 +40,9 @@ Future<ImageProvider> packageIcon(
final bytes = await ref
.watch(platformSettingsProvider)
.getPackageIcon(packageName)
.getOrElse((l) {
_logger.warning("error getting package icon: $l");
throw l;
.getOrElse((err) {
_logger.warning("error getting package icon", err);
throw err;
}).run();
return MemoryImage(bytes);
}